- 博客(7)
- 收藏
- 关注
QGraphicsView中选中QGraphicsPathItem使之不出现虚线框
绘制一条贝赛尔曲线,当选中该曲线时,显示其控制点并把控制点和起始点连结起来,从而可以清晰的显示曲线的参数。 # -*- coding: utf-8 -*-from PyQt4 import QtGui, QtCoreclass PathItem(QtGui.QGraphicsPathItem): def __init__(self, parent=None, s...
2010-10-01 20:46:36 705
原创 PyQt4主窗体设置停靠窗口(QDockWidget)的叠加顺序
PyQt提供了方便的停靠窗口控件,我们可以很方便的编写一个停靠窗口,代码和效果如下: # -*- coding: utf-8 -*-from PyQt4 import QtGui, QtCoreclass MainWindow(QtGui.QMainWindow): def __init__(self): QtGui.QMainWindow....
2010-09-24 16:26:03 462
PyQt中如何隐藏Menu
PyQt中隐藏一个Menu Item,可以通过QAction的setVisible(False)来设置,而QMenu的setVisible(False)是不管用的。 现在问题来了,我们有一个菜单,它有一些子菜单,如何隐藏它呢? fileMenu = self.menuBar().addMenu('File')self.newMenu = fileMenu.addMenu(...
2010-07-10 11:24:34 1038 1
SimPy: Simulation with SimPy
所有离散事件程序自动以软件时钟的方式保持当前模拟时间。在SimPy中可以通过now()函数得到当前模拟时间,在模拟开始的时候,软件时钟设置为0.0。用户不能直接改变软件时钟。 当模拟软件运行时,当前模拟时间随着事件进行一步步增加。随着模拟系统状态的改变,事件随时会发生。如:顾客的到达就是一个事件,同理,顾客的离开也是。 使用SimPy是必须载入Simu...
2007-10-28 13:29:15 1239
SimPy: Introduction
SimPy是一个基于Python的离散事件系统。它采用并行技术处理各种活动组件,如消息、顾客、卡车、飞机等等。它为程序员提供了一系列工具,包括Processes(进程),三种资源工具(Resources,Levels和Stores),以及记录结果用的Monitors和Tallys。 SimPy中最基本的活动元素是进程(即Process类的实例),它们可以延迟一会,这...
2007-10-28 00:47:23 869
Python离散事件系统包SimPy
SimPy(Simulation in Python)是基于Python的一个离散事件系统的包,允许您非常方便的创建离散事件系统的模型。通过它可以对现实世界中的情况建立模型,通过模拟运行,来发现是否存在一些缺陷,对过程等作出优化。 由于最近正在学习这个包,顺便把文档做下翻译。...
2007-10-27 22:55:07 970
Ruby转Exe -- Exerb研究
1. Exerb简介Exerb是一个将ruby脚本程序(.rb)转换成Windows应用程序(.exe)的软件。目前最新版本4.1.0,下载地址:http://downloads.sourceforge.jp/exerb/23470/exerb-4.1.0.zip。2.安装把下载的zip文件解压,进入exerb目录,运行ruby setup.rb。这时exerb和mkexy命令将会加入...
2007-02-01 00:09:00 138
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人